- [ ] Step 7: Archive cold storage buckets (Glacierline tier). Confirm both ceremony witnesses are present, verify bucket manifests match the Oxbow ledger, then seal the archive key shares. Plugin authors may observe but not handle shares. Once sealed, the archive index itself is encrypted and can only be reopened with the passphrase below.

vault phrase of badup-hahig = tamael-aldael-kelmir-istael-fenok-istwyn-tamius-jorath-oliion

// DEDUP_MATCH_THRESHOLD sets the minimum similarity score at which
// Greymantle treats two customer records as duplicates. Plugin authors
// should not lower this value; false merges are irreversible once the
// nightly compactor runs. Scores are computed by the canonical matcher
// only. This threshold was calibrated against the dataset tagged with
// the trace token below.

session token of tajog-fahaf = htk21_4ae55819f45410afcb307

Ticket: InkSlip vault locked itself again.

Hey on-call — the secrets vault backing the InkSlip PDF invoice renderer sealed during the overnight cert rotation, so invoice jobs are failing with signing errors. Customers at Marrowfield have already noticed. Quick fix: unseal the vault from the render-primary host, then requeue failed jobs with the replay script. Don't restart the renderer first; it drops the queue. The unseal prompt wants the recovery passphrase:

unlock words, hahip-baduf: holwyn-istath-julvan

For branch managers: Orrister Holdings has agreed to sell its Coldvane packaging unit to an external buyer, with completion expected next quarter. The unit contributed a small but stable share of group revenue; proceeds will reduce borrowings and fund refurbishment of remaining branches. Branch reporting lines are unchanged until completion, and Coldvane orders in the pipeline will be honoured. Staff communications are being handled centrally. The confidential note on onward plans sits below.

board note of yagaf-yawig: Project Gorvan slips by one quarter because of the staffing delay.